REGN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

903 of the 5,651 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Regeneron Pharmaceuticals (REGN)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$44.3B — down 14% from $51.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 141 funds opened new REGN positions and 135 closed out — a net gain of 6 holders — while 375 added to existing stakes and 281 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Susquehanna International Group, adding an estimated $280M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$668M.
